Masashi Watanabe is a scholar working on Materials Chemistry, Biomedical Engineering and Mechanical Engineering. According to data from OpenAlex, Masashi Watanabe has authored 63 papers receiving a total of 839 indexed citations (citations by other indexed papers that have themselves been cited), including 40 papers in Materials Chemistry, 14 papers in Biomedical Engineering and 11 papers in Mechanical Engineering. Recurrent topics in Masashi Watanabe’s work include Nuclear Materials and Properties (14 papers), Nuclear materials and radiation effects (7 papers) and Nuclear reactor physics and engineering (7 papers). Masashi Watanabe is often cited by papers focused on Nuclear Materials and Properties (14 papers), Nuclear materials and radiation effects (7 papers) and Nuclear reactor physics and engineering (7 papers). Masashi Watanabe collaborates with scholars based in Japan, United States and United Kingdom. Masashi Watanabe's co-authors include Christopher J. Kiely, Graham J. Hutchings, Jennifer K. Edwards, Albert F. Carley, Andrew A. Herzing, Philip Landon, Benjamín Solsona, Zenji Horita, Satoshi Ohtsuka and Hiroshi Oka and has published in prestigious journals such as Nano Letters, Applied Physics Letters and Journal of Applied Physics.
